What does Avihai mean and where does it come from?

Avihai is derived from Hebrew roots 'avi' meaning 'my father' and 'chai' meaning 'alive'.

Cultural significance
The name is used in Hebrew-speaking communities and has biblical connotations.

Famous people named Avihai

AM
Avihai Mandelblit
An Israeli lawyer and former Attorney General of Israel.
